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update step by step and install it as an extension #1471

Merged
merged 2 commits into from
Jul 29, 2022

Conversation

joelanman
Copy link
Contributor

@joelanman joelanman commented Jul 19, 2022

closes #1081

This PR:

  • Imports Step by Step Sass and Javascript via an extension
  • Updates the Step by Step templates

Notes and draft guidance for users

To do:

  • Publish Step by step as an npm module (currently its importing from github)
  • I need to credit @domoscargin on the commits but I'm not sure how
  • Document how to keep using the old version of Step by step

@govuk-design-system-ci govuk-design-system-ci temporarily deployed to govuk-protot-update-ste-ap1yke July 19, 2022 12:45 Inactive
@joelanman joelanman mentioned this pull request Jul 19, 2022
3 tasks
@joelanman joelanman marked this pull request as draft July 19, 2022 13:03
@joelanman
Copy link
Contributor Author

draft until we publish step by step on npm, so we can switch package.json over

@joelanman
Copy link
Contributor Author

seems like the step by step tests fail, which is good, @BenSurgisonGDS can you help me fix them?

@BenSurgisonGDS BenSurgisonGDS force-pushed the update-step-by-step-2 branch 2 times, most recently from e59e329 to 7ebd60f Compare July 29, 2022 09:40
@joelanman joelanman changed the title Use step by step as an extension Update step by step and install it as an extension Jul 29, 2022
@joelanman joelanman marked this pull request as ready for review July 29, 2022 10:26
Copy link
Member

@lfdebrux lfdebrux left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Great stuff! Let's :shipit:

@joelanman joelanman merged commit b90bd51 into main Jul 29, 2022
@joelanman joelanman deleted the update-step-by-step-2 branch July 29, 2022 12:40
@lfdebrux lfdebrux mentioned this pull request Jul 29, 2022
@lfdebrux lfdebrux mentioned this pull request Aug 23, 2022
@lfdebrux lfdebrux mentioned this pull request Nov 17,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

The Step by step pattern is out of date
4 participants